首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Excel小技巧54: 同时多个工作表输入数据

excelperfect 很多情形下,我们都需要在多个工作表中有同样数据。此时,可以使用Excel“组”功能,当在一个工作表输入数据时,这些数据也被同时输入到其它成组工作表。...如下图1所示,将工作表成组后,一个工作表输入数据将同时输入到其它工作表。 ?...图1 要成组工作表,先按住Ctrl键,然后工作簿左下角单击要加入组工作表名称,此时工作簿标题中会出现“名称+组”,如下图2所示。 ?...图2 注意,如果一直保持工作表“组合”状态,可能会不小心工作表输入其它工作表不想要内容。因此,要及时解除组合状态。...单击除用于输入内容工作表外任意工作表名称,则可解除工作表组合;或者工作表名称标签单击右键,快捷菜单中选取“取消组合工作表”命令。

3.1K20

Excel公式技巧94:不同工作表查找数据

很多时候,我们都需要从工作簿各工作表中提取数据信息。如果你在给工作表命名时遵循一定规则,那么可以将VLOOKUP函数与INDIRECT函数结合使用,以从不同工作表中提取数据。...这项技术可以节省时间,提高效率。 假如有一张包含各种客户销售数据表,并且每个月都会收到一张新工作表。这里,给工作表选择命名规则时要保持一致。...汇总表上,我们希望从每个月份工作表查找给客户XYZ销售额。假设你单元格区域B3:D3输入有日期,包括2020年1月、2020年2月、2020年3月,单元格A4输入有客户名称。...每个月销售表结构是列A是客户名称,列B是销售额。...当你有多个统一结构数据源工作表,并需要从中提取数据时,本文介绍技巧尤其有用。 注:本文整理自vlookupweek.wordpress.com,供有兴趣朋友参考。 undefined

13K10
您找到你想要的搜索结果了吗?
是的
没有找到

单列文本拆分为多列,Python可以自动化

标签:Python与Excel,pandas Excel,我们经常会遇到要将文本拆分。Excel文本拆分为列,可以使用公式、“分列”功能或Power Query来实现。...虽然Excel这样做是可以,但在Python这样做从来都不是正确。上述操作:创建一个公式然后下拉,对于编程语言来说,被称为“循环”。...Python,矢量化操作是处理数据标准方法,因为它比循环快数百倍。后续我们会讨论为什么它要快得多。...注意:返回结果是两个单词(字符串)列表。 那么,如何将其应用于数据框架列?你可能已经明白了,我们使用.str!让我们“姓名”列尝试一下,以获得名字和姓氏。...我们想要是将文本分成两列(pandas系列),需要用到split()方法一个可选参数:expand。当将其设置为True时,可以将拆分项目返回到不同

6.9K10

使用Python将数据保存到Excel文件

标签:Python与Excel,Pandas 前面,我们已经学习了如何从Excel文件读取数据,参见: Python pandas读取Excel文件 使用Python pandas读取多个Excel...工作表 Python读取多个Excel文件 如何打开巨大csv文件或文本文件 接下来,要知道另一件重要事情是如何使用Python将数据保存回Excel文件。...为什么要再回到Excel?嗯,因为我们大多数人只熟悉Excel,所以我们必须说他们语言。...可能通常不使用此选项,因为保存到文件之前,可以在数据框架删除列。 保存数据到CSV文件 我们可以使用df.to_csv()将相同数据框架保存到csv文件。...本文讲解了如何将一个数据框架保存到Excel文件,如果你想将多个数据框架保存到同一个Excel文件,请继续关注完美Excel

18.6K40

【干货】50个Excel常用功能,一秒变数据处理专家

Excel添加说明文字 8、Excel数据分列整理 9、Excel数据合并 10、Excel添加常用文件夹 11、Excel添加多个视图 12、Excel设置打印区域 13、...Excel录制“宏” 14、Excel建立图表 15、Excel获取网络数据 16、用好Excel“搜索函数” 17、Excel插入超级链接 18、Excel打印指定页面 19、Excel...中直接编辑“宏” 20、用窗体调用“宏” 21、Excel运行“宏” 22、设置Excel标签颜色 23、防止Excel数据重复输入 24、给Excel数据添加单位 25、更改Excel缺省文件保存位置...正确输入身份证号码 33、Excel数据排序操作 34、Excel数据表格如何将姓名信息按笔画排列 35、Excel数据格式设置 36:Excel自定输入数据下拉列表 37、Excel内置序列批量填充...38、Excel模版保存和调用 39、Excel监视窗口 40、Excel中行列隐藏操作 41、Excel工作簿加密保存 42、Excel公式引用方式转换 43、Excel特殊符号输入 44、Excel

26.2K103

Python与Excel协同应用初学者指南

如何将数据框架写入Excel文件 由于使用.csv或.xlsx文件格式Pandas中装载和读取文件,类似地,可以将Pandas数据框架保存为使用.xlsxExcel文件,或保存为.csv文件。...通过这种方式,可以将包含数据工作表添加到现有工作簿,该工作簿可能有许多工作表:可以使用ExcelWriter将多个不同数据框架保存到一个包含多个工作表工作簿。...想象一下,作为一名开发人员,将在多个不同项目上工作,每个项目可能需要具有不同版本不同软件包。当你项目有冲突需求时,虚拟环境就会派上用场。...通过一个示例来理解它,在这个示例,将使用Python代码手动创建工作簿并向其写入数据: 图23 自动化数据写入过程 自动化Excel文件数据写入过程至关重要,尤其是当想将数据写入文件,但又不想花时间手动将数据输入文件时...下面是一个示例,说明如何使用pyexcel包函数get_array()将Excel数据转换为数组格式: 图25 让我们了解一下如何将Excel数据转换为有序列表字典。

17.3K20

50个逆天功能,看完变Excel绝顶高手(全都是动图!)

Excel数据分列整理 9、Excel数据合并 10、Excel添加常用文件夹 11、Excel添加多个视图 12、Excel设置打印区域 13、Excel录制“宏” 14、Excel...建立图表 15、Excel获取网络数据 16、用好Excel“搜索函数” 17、Excel插入超级链接 18、Excel打印指定页面 19、Excel中直接编辑“宏” 20、用窗体调用...“宏” 21、Excel运行“宏” 22、设置Excel标签颜色 23、防止Excel数据重复输入 24、给Excel数据添加单位 25、更改Excel缺省文件保存位置 26、保护Excel 工作簿...27、按钮调用“宏” 28、Excel自定义自动填充序列 29、Excel设置数据对齐方式 30、Excel字符格式设置 31、Excel自定输入数据下拉列表 32、Excel正确输入身份证号码 33...、Excel数据排序操作 34、Excel数据表格如何将姓名信息按笔画排列 35、Excel数据格式设置 37、Excel内置序列批量填充 38、Excel模版保存和调用 39、Excel监视窗口

2.1K60

Excel与Power BI互通

而反过来,对于很多还不是很熟悉Power BI小伙伴来说,也可以将PBI制作模型和文件很方便回到Excel,进行分析和展示。...---- 一、Excel 与 Power BI Desktop(桌面版) 首先,来看看如何将Excel发布到PBI Desktop 桌面版,实际上应该反着来做,PBI文件菜单,选择导入,然后选择需要被导入...点击“转至Power BI”,系统会自动带您进入浏览器查看发布内容。这里界面是Excel Online,和本地版操作起来没有什么不同。 ? 点击透视图或透视表,可以激活布局调整窗口 ?...---- 三、Power BI Server(网页版)与 Excel 通过PBI网页端,可以很顺畅下载到ExcelExcel里进行分析。 选择“REPORTS",需要下载报告 ?...没错,这就是一个Excel文件,里面已经包含了所有的数据关系和度量值。大家可以按照自己需要进行操作,和普通Excel文件没有什么不同

6.7K10

excel常用操作大全

例如,excel输入单位的人员信息后,如果需要在原出生年份数字前再加两位数字,即在每个人出生年份前再加两位数字19,如果逐个修改太麻烦,那么我们可以使用以下方法来节省时间和精力: 1)假设年份...5.如果一个Excel文件中有多个工作表,如何将多个工作表同时设置为相同页眉和页脚?如何一次打印多个工作表? EXCEL菜单视图-页眉和页脚,您可以设置页眉和页脚来标记信息。...13.如何将一个或多个选定格单元拖放到新位置?按住Shift键可以快速修改单元格格内容顺序。...20、如何快速输入数据序列?如果您需要在表格输入一些特殊数据系列,如物料序列号和日期系列,请不要逐个输入。为什么不让Excel自动填写它们呢?...第一个单元格输入起始数据,在下一个单元格输入第二个数据,选择这两个单元格,将光标指向单元格右下角填充手柄,沿着要填充方向拖动填充手柄,拖动单元格将按照Excel中指定顺序自动填充。

19.1K10

,当Pandas遇上Excel会擦出什么样火花呢?!

Excel是我们职场打工人接触最多办公室软件之一,当中会涉及到很多重复操作,好在Python为我们提供了很多操作Excel模块,能够帮助我们极大地提高工作效率,从琐碎工作时间中抽出身来。...今天我们要介绍模块是xlsxwriter,它主要功能是Excel表格当中插入数据、插入图表,以及进行一系列数据处理, xlsxwriter模块安装 直接在命令行输入 pip install xlsxwriter...我们来实现一下如何将多个DataFrame数据保存在一张Excel表格当中,并且分成不同sheet import pandas as pd # 创建几个DataFrame数据集 df1 = pd.DataFrame...文件,不同Sheet当中分别存放着指定数据集 将多个DataFrame数据集放在一张Sheet当中 将多个DataFrame数据集放在同一张Sheet当中,通过当中参数startcol与startrow...下面我们来看一下,如何利用Pandas来根据表格数据绘制柱状图,并且保存在Excel表格当中,xlsxwriter模块当中有add_chart()方法,提供了9图表绘制方法,我们先来看一下柱状图绘制

1.2K40

Excel VBA解读(137): 让使用用户定义函数数组公式更快

学习Excel技术,关注微信公众号: excelperfect Excel数组公式能够做很多令人惊讶事情。除了输入完后要按Ctrl+Shift+Enter组合键外,与普通公式一样。...本文主要研究使用用户定义函数数组公式。 有两类数组公式: 单单元格数组公式输入单个单元格,循环遍历其参数(通常是计算参数)并返回单个结果。...多单元格数组公式输入多个单元格每个单元格中都返回结果。 使用这种功能需要付出代价:因为数组公式正处理很多工作,所以计算速度很慢(特别是单单元格数组公式)。...每次VBA读写调用都有相当大开销,因此一次读取和写入大块数据通常要快得多。 因此,应该让VBA用户定义函数单个块尽可能多地读取数据并将数据尽可能大地返回到Excel。...我们沿用《Excel VBA解读(133):编写高效Function过程——让代码运行更快技术》示例,创建自定义函数数组版本AverageTolE函数,功能是找到除多个误差之外数据平均值。

3.3K20

SpringMVC上传、解析Excel

示例:导入相关数据Excel文件),相关文件数据编辑好。 ? XML文件配置 再springxml文件配置要上传文件大小 <!...= null){ b = true; } //迭代添加信息(注:实际上这里也可以直接将cpolicyList集合作为参数,Mybatis相应映射文件中使用...不过这首先得判断Excel版本而选择不同Workbook方式(2003版本对应是HSSFWorkbook,2007版本及以上对应是XSSFWorkbook)。...此外,一般来说先将在客户端用户上传文件拷贝一份至服务器本地磁盘,然后再从这个拷贝文件中进行读取,这样就避免了因客户端网络异常或其他状况而在读取时造成数据流失或损坏情况。...里面的内容读取客户信息 * @param is 输入流 * @param isExcel2003 excel是2003还是2007版本 * @return * @

1.6K10

5种常用格式数据输出,手把手教你用Pandas实现

=False) 多个数据导出如下: # 将多个df分不同sheet导入一个Excel文件 with pd.ExcelWriter('path_to_file.xlsx') as writer:...: # 指定操作引擎 df.to_excel('path_to_file.xlsx', sheet_name='Sheet1', engine='xlsxwriter') # 'engine'参数设置...代码table标签输入一个字符串,这部分HTML代码可以放在网页中进行展示,也可以作为邮件正文。...print(df.to_html(classes=['class1', 'class2'])) 04 数据库(SQL) 将DataFrame数据保存到数据对应表: # 需要安装SQLAlchemy...中国人工智能学会会员,企业数字化、数据产品和数据分析讲师,个人网站“盖若”上编写技术和产品教程广受欢迎。

38820

个人永久性免费-Excel催化剂功能第31波-数量金额分组凑数功能,财务表哥表姐最爱

财务工作过程,很大时候需要使用到凑数需求,花了两三天时间认真研究了一下,本人水平也只能做代码搬运工,在用户体验上作了一下完善。完成了Excel凑数功能。...业务场景 有财务朋友分享了一需求,开发票过程,需要一张发票发多个商品明细,有可能累计了许多款项一次性给予开具发票,而同时发票又有面额最大限制要求。...规划求解类函数,暂时做了两个同一功能不同来源 因凑数计算量大,而使用函数向导方向输入的话,每输入一个参数都运算一遍,还有可能卡机报错等,建议使用手动输入方式,输入两个参数。...函数输入参数说明 计算结果存放在记录表某一列,用是数组公式方式返回多个值,故若需要修改删除,请使用功能区数组函数相关删除、数值化、选择等快捷操作。 ?...2018年开始职业生涯作了重大调整,从原来正职工作,转为自由职业者,暂无固定收入,暂对前面道路不太明朗,苦重新回到正职工作,对Excel催化剂运营和开发必定受到很大影响(正职工作时间内不可能维护也不可能随便把工作时间成果公布于外

1.7K20

PBI催化剂较Tabular Editor好用易用之处

除了上述说到需要掌握C#语言才能编写外,退一万步,就算已经掌握了语言,Tabular Editor作者所使用方式,他没有将数据导出到Excel文件,而是使用tsv格式(以制表符为分隔符文本文件...针对上述提到三大痛点问题,且看在PBI催化剂如何将其一一破解,带出一个超级棒操作流程与体验。 PBI催化剂,无需任何代码,即可界面方式完成所需导出对象选择及其对应属性进一步细分选择。...且存在换行符、制表符错乱问题,导出数据需要整理很长时间,导入数据时,如果需要修改DAX表达式等含有换行符、制表符,最终只能得到错误结果。...当然其他更为复杂属性搜索,可以重新回到遍历属性功能里,将所有属性都遍历导出到Excel,再从Excel简单查找、筛选功能,发现最终想找到对象及其信息。...同时也因为两者开发者知识体系及面对服务群体不同,PBI催化剂,更适用于没有.NET语言基础纯工具使用群体,特别是从Excel用户过渡而来PowerBI爱好者。

2.3K30

《Python for Excel》读书笔记连载1:为什么为Excel选择Python?

Python诞生于1991年,比Excel晚了六年。虽然Excel很早就开始流行,但Python花了更长时间某些领域(例如web开发或系统管理)得到采用。...执行这种嵌套函数调用与其他编程语言工作方式没有什么不同,只是单元格编写代码,而不是文本文件编写代码。...这个应用程序工作方式是:分别在单元格A4和B4输入金额和货币,Excel将在单元格D4将其转换为美元。...后面,我们将基于这些层构建一个真正应用程序:Excel将是展示层,而业务层和数据层将移到PythonPython更容易正确地构造代码。 DRY原则 DRY原则:不要重复自己。...PowerBI希望通过交互式仪表板可视化大型数据集来理解它们。它核心依赖于与Excel相同PowerQuery和PowerPivot功能。

5.2K20

011 Ruby 多Word表写入Excel

你关心是,Ruby能否像VBA、Python一样, 实现多表格快速汇总? 答案是肯定。 011.png 这期,为你讲解如何将多个Word表格汇总到Excel里。...为了方便演示,我只模拟了3个Word数据文件。 001 需求分析 表格里有培训名称、培训时间、主办方、培训地点、培训内容等项目。...Word表和Excel大致存储原理大致相同,他们都是由一个个cell组成,但不同是,Excel里单元格对象是cells,而在Word里它则变成了cell。...002 思路解析 解题思路: 第一步,通过Ruby调用Office接口,打开Word、Excel。 第二步,将Word表指定位置数据写入数组保存。第三步,将数组数据一次性写入Excel保存。...1..t).each{|i| # 培训名称 arr[s][0]=wdc.tables(i).cell(1,2).range.text.chop # 培训时间

68400

Python读书笔记(数字型数据

如果在Python输入一个数字,则默认为10进制,如何变为2进制、8进制和16进制呢? 1、输入0b开头为二进制 2、输入0o开头为八进制 3、输入0x开头为十六进制 ?...PythonIDLE中将不同进制数字转化为10进制数字! 换算进制用处比较少,还说说和Excel一样常用一些运算字符吧! ? Python上应用效果如下! ?...相对于Excel,Python整除和求余不用借助外在函数,直接用运算符实现即可! 接下来和大家分享如何将文本强制转化为数字。 Excel当中如何将文本强制转换为数字呢?...当用文本3.14加上一个数字1是不能直接出来运算结果,当int直接转化字符串3.14时也没有转化成功,给大家介绍两个东东! ? ? 先说明一下哦!双引号下都是文本,和Excel是一样。...最后给大家介绍一个数字常见函数,保留N位小数,这个函数和Excel是一样用法哦! Round(小数,保留几位小数) ? 嗯 就这么多~

1.1K50

音视频之音频相关概念介绍

如何将模拟信号转成数字信号,这就需要采样了。...信号处理,各个功能处理信号频率可能是不一样,比如在混合多个音频流时候,各个音频流采样频率可能是不一样, 这时候就需要重采样,让各音频流在混音之前先重采样成一样频率和声道。...采样时长 按照前面的介绍,就可以理解单位时间内采样音频数据大小计算了,1s音频数据大小是: image.png f是采样频率,Channels是声道数,BytesPerSample是采样字节数。...就是音频信号中去掉噪音,简单原理就是识别音频语音信号和噪声信号,然后将噪声信号去掉。...SCO用于通话场景,建立连接时间比较长,大概3秒左右。 耳就是采集端建一个回路,可以将采集数据实时播放出来。

1.2K10

Python实现ExcelVLOOKUP、HLOOKUP、XLOOKUP函数功能

此外,我们可以使用INDEX/MATCH组合,但这需要更多输入最新Office,Microsfot推出了XLOOKUP公式,但它只Office 365可用。...图1 Python实现XLOOKUP 我们将使用pandas库来复制Excel公式,该库几乎相当于Python电子表格应用程序。...第一行,我们用一些参数定义了一个名为xlookup函数: lookup_value:我们感兴趣值,这将是一个字符串值 lookup_array:这是源数据框架一列,我们正在查找此数组/列...默认情况下,其值是=0,代表行,而axis=1表示列 args=():这是一个元组,包含要传递到func位置参数 下面是如何将xlookup函数应用到数据框架整个列。...根据设计,apply将自动传递来自调用方数据框架(系列)所有数据我们示例,apply()将df1['用户姓名']作为第一个参数传递给函数xlookup。

6.6K10
领券